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has confirmed Paul Pogba missed out on the Manchester United squad which faced Watford in the FA Cup on Saturday due to injury.
Victor Lindelof and Luke Shaw were also ruled out before the game, and the United boss will also have to check on Eric Bailly after he suffered a blow to the head during the match.
Pogba's 2019-20 season was marred by an ankle injury which required surgery and kept him out of action for many weeks.

He also had a spell on the side lines this season, missing a few games due to an ankle problem he picked up on international duty with France.
